OBSERVER COASTAL | Pensioner caught with N$100k illicit cigarettes near Usakos
[Windhoek Observer - Namibia] - 18/09/2025
Renthia Kaimbi An 81-year-old pensioner was arrested on Monday after police in the Erongo region found illicit tobacco products worth nearly N$100 000 during a routine traffic stop near Usakos. Senior inspector Judith Shomungula of the Erongo Police said officers searched a white Toyota Quantum (…)
